非常风气网www.verywind.cn
首页
简单的rsa
帮我解释一下
RSA
算法的原理
答:
RSA简洁幽雅,但计算速度比较慢,通常加密中并不是直接使用RSA 来对所有的信息进行加密,最常见的情况是随机产生一个对称加密的密钥,然后使用对称加密算法对信息加密,之后用 RSA对刚才的加密密钥进行加密。最后需要说明的是,当前小于1024位的N已经被证明是不安全的 自己使用中不要使用小于1024位
的RSA
,...
什么是
RSA
算法,求
简单
解释。
答:
RSA
公钥加密算法是1977年由Ron Rivest、Adi Shamirh和LenAdleman在(美国麻省理工学院)开发的。RSA取名来自开发他们三者的名字。RSA是目前最有影响力的公钥加密算法,它能够 抵抗到目前为止已知的所有密码攻击,已被ISO推荐为公钥数据加密标准。RSA算法基于一个十分
简单的
数论事实:将两个大素数相乘十分容易...
RSA
的C++语言描述
简单
实现
答:
综上所述,RSA算法在C++语言中的实现需要综合考虑大数处理、算法优化和安全性等多个方面,通过合理的策略和高效的数据结构选择,可以构建出既稳定又高效
的RSA
加密系统。在RSA算法的C++实现中,推荐使用现有的库函数,如使用``库进行输入输出操作,使用``或``来高效处理大数,同时考虑引入``库来优化算法结...
密码学中
的rsa
算法是什么
答:
RSA
公开密钥密码体制的原理是:根据数论,寻求两个大素数比较
简单
,而将它们的乘积进行因式分解却极其困难,因此可以将乘积公开作为加密密钥 算法描述:RSA算法的具体描述如下:(1)任意选取两个不同的大素数p和q计算乘积 (2)任意选取一个大整数e,满足整数e用做加密钥(注意:e的选取是很容易的,例...
图文彻底搞懂非对称加密(公钥密钥)
答:
RSA
是现在使用最为广泛的非对称加密算法,本节我们来
简单
介绍 RSA 加解密的过程。 RSA 加解密算法其实很简单: 密文=明文^E mod N 明文=密文^D mod N RSA 算法并不会像对称加密一样,用玩魔方的方式来打乱原始信息。RSA 加、解密中使用了是同样的数 N。公钥是公开的,意味着 N 也是公开的。所以私钥也可以...
简单
介绍
RSA
证书的生成算法
答:
首先,选两个质数,p,q.(一般选择的p,q很大,这就是它保密性的保证,因为分解一个大整数是很困难的)然后计算出p*q = k和(p-1)*(q-1) = u 接下来选一个与u互质的奇数e 然后找出这个关于x的不定方程的解x0:e*x = u*k + 1 k是任意整数.这个方程用扩展欧几里得可以解出.然后把e和k...
一个
RSA
算法的加密运算,需要完整的演算过程。
答:
RSA
是非对称加密体系,也就是说加密用一个公钥,解密用一个私钥,这2个密钥不同,这点非常非常重要。其实RSA非常简洁,但很美 流程 1,寻找2个大的素数p,q n=p*q=33 N=(p-1)*(q-1)=20 公钥e一般是3 私钥d要通过公钥e去算出来 e*d=1(mod N) 就是说e和d的乘积模N得1 也...
密码学基础 |
RSA
算法详解及证明
答:
正确性证明
RSA
的正确性基于欧拉函数和欧拉定理,通过互素和非互素的讨论,证明了加密和解密过程的可行性。安全性分析在加密和数字签名场景中,RSA的安全性源于大数因子分解的难度。尽管没有理论上的绝对保证,但至今没有找到更
简单的
方法破解。局限性尽管是优秀方案,RSA仍存在理论证明不完善、密钥生成复杂...
RSA
算法详解
答:
非对称加密的原理:将a和b相乘得出乘积c很容易,但要是想要通过乘积c推导出a和b极难。即对一个大数进行因式分解极难 目前公开破译的位数是768位,实际使用一般是1024位或是2048位,所以理论上特别的安全。
RSA
算法的核心就是欧拉定理,根据它我们才能得到私钥,从而保证整个通信的安全。
rsa
算法原理
答:
RSA
算法是最常用的非对称加密算法,它既能用于加密,也能用于数字签名。RSA的安全基于大数分解的难度。其公钥和私钥是一对大素数(100到200位十进制数或更大)的函数。从一个公钥和密文恢复出明文的难度,等价于分解两个大素数之积。我们可以通过一个
简单的
例子来理解RSA的工作原理。为了便于计算。在...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
你可能感兴趣的内容
列举一个rsa算法的计算案例
rsa算法推导
Rsa基础
rsa加密算法例子
rsa加密算法 QP
rsa加密算法破解
rsa算法应用
rsa加密算法verilog
复数域rsa解题
本站内容来自于网友发表,不代表本站立场,仅表示其个人看法,不对其真实性、正确性、有效性作任何的担保
相关事宜请发邮件给我们
©
非常风气网